The cumulative relative frequency graph describes the
distribution of median household incomes in the 50 states in a
recent year. Given are summary statistics for the state median
household incomes. New Jersey had a standardized score of
1.82.
Find New Jersey's median household income for that
year.
$51,742.44
$36,799.08
$64,952.36
$66,685.80
O $51,740.62

Mean SD Min
Med Q3 Max
50 51,742.44 8210.64 36,641 46,071 50,009 57,020 71,836

Respuesta :

Using z-scores, it is found that the New Jersey's median household income for that  year was of $66,685.80 .

--------------------------------

The z-score for a measure X in a data-set with mean [tex]\mu[/tex] and standard deviation [tex]\sigma[/tex] is given by:

[tex]Z = \frac{X - \mu}{\sigma}[/tex]

In this problem:

  • The mean is of $51,742.44, thus [tex]\mu = 51742.44[/tex].
  • The standard deviation is of $8,210.64, thus [tex]\sigma = 8210.64[/tex].
  • The standardized score for the median New Jersey household income is [tex]Z = 1.82[/tex], thus, this measure is of X.

[tex]Z = \frac{X - \mu}{\sigma}[/tex]

[tex]1.82 = \frac{X - 51742.44}{8210.64}[/tex]

[tex]X - 51742.44 = 1.82(8210.64)[/tex]

[tex]X = 66685.60[/tex]

Then, the New Jersey's median household income for that  year was of $66,685.80 .
